Michael Larsen Exhibition



A New exhibition opens on Saturday April 10th at Energyart Gallery.

Local artist Michael Larsen's first exhibition cocnsists of a collection of Large scale Abstract and Resin Glass Paintings.


Many of the pieces are stunning as they stand alone on a wall, yet once viewed through 3D glasses, (which Michael will supply to viewers) come to life like magical creatures and take
on another aspect entirely. The colours leap from the canvas and take thier rightful places in layers, a depth of field not experience outside the 3D movies in modern theatres.

Alongside Michael are two other wonderful local artists (Joyce Thomas & Lainie Jubb) exhibiting a range of paintings styles. This team of three have put together a wonderful exhibition not to be missed.

Latest Painting...hot off the Easel

My latest painting was a wonderful whimsical painting commissioned by a beauftiful young family.



It is 1.5m x 1m acrylic image on canvas.



The image is of the 3 members of the family, Dad and two children and includes images of the three dogs that they have had(and currently have) as family pets.



It was a wonderful experience, working with the Dad to ensure we captured the essence of the family, thier faces, clothes and positions imitating thier personalities. We met at least 5 times throughout the process and made little personal changes as the painting came to life. Even the children had an opportunity to view the work during creation and offer suggestions to help make it a little more personal and meaningful for them.



The colours reflect the Australian landscape, with a simple city image to depict our city of Brisbane.



Some of the symbols in the painting are the pets, frangpani tree, Old Queenslander homes (thiers included), vibrant Australian outback colours, Story bridge and fun family times in the park, enjoying the Qld weather.



I loved creating thie image and can't wait to do more images like this one!
